currious to know rpm at 17 knt. also , according to most posts here the yan. 110 would be wide-open ???...............john
 
3750 RPM 18 knots and about 7.5 GPH

Full fuel, ½ water, some gear, 2 S.O.B.

The best part, it is a very quiet engine.
If you close the cabin door, it sounds like a
sewing machine is powering the boat.....
